Note: On "Vega 10", the boot voltage of the SVI2 regulator is 0.9 V controlled by the GPU;
overwriting of boot-VID on the PCB is not allowed. If the second domain of the SVI2 regulator
is used to power a GPU rail (e.g., VDDCR_HBM/VDDIO_MEM) that cannot work with 0.9 V,
contact AMD for alternative solutions.

Serial VID clock.
Push-pull clock output for the SVI2
On-die PU
data bus; driven by the GPU. Point-to-
point connection to the SVI2 voltage
regulator controller.
Serial VID data.
Push-pull data output for the SVI2 data
bus; driven by the GPU. Sets the
voltage, power-state indicator, load-
On-die PD
line slope, and voltage offsets for two
voltage rails. Point-to-point connection
to the SVI2 voltage regulator
controller.
Serial VID telemetry.
Push-pull data input driven by the SVI2
voltage regulator controller.
Continuously streams the voltage and
-
current telemetry information to the
GPU. Also provides an indication when
positive voltage transitions are
complete (VOTFC).
